Understanding Different Types of Prams
Prams come in various designs, each designed to cater to particular needs and preferences. Below is a table detailing the most common types of prams and their specifying features:
Type of Pram
Description
Perfect For
Cost Range
Standard Pram
Fundamental model for daily use, often with a set seat
Casual getaways and short strolls
₤ 150 - ₤ 600
Travel System
Consists of a stroller and a baby car seat
Moms and dads who drive frequently
₤ 250 - ₤ 800
All-Terrain Pram
Created with rugged wheels for off-road use
Active families and outside experiences
₤ 200 - ₤ 900
Lightweight Pram
Compact and easy to bring, often foldable
Urban dwellers, public transport users
₤ 100 - ₤ 400
Double Pram
Accommodates two kids, can be side-by-side or tandem
Moms and dads with twins or brother or sisters
₤ 300 - ₤ 1,200
Jogging Stroller
Developed for running with larger, air-filled wheels
Active parents who delight in running
₤ 200 - ₤ 700
Key Features to Consider
When choosing a pram, a number of key functions can affect your general experience. Here is a list of necessary features to look out for:
- Weight and Portability: A lightweight pram is easier to steer and carry, especially if utilizing public transportation.
- Foldability: Look for prams that fold quickly, particularly if you have restricted storage space in your home or car.
- Security Features: Ensure that the pram fulfills security standards, and look for features such as a five-point harness, locking wheels, and a tough frame.
- Convenience: The seat should have appropriate padding, and adjustable recline positions are essential for newborns and older babies.
- Storage Space: A big storage basket is useful for carrying diaper bags, groceries, and other basics.
- Maneuverability: Test the pram's wheel style to see how quickly it turns and browses various terrains.
- Canopy: A large sunshade can safeguard your kid from hazardous UV rays, making outside adventures more satisfying.
- Cost: Set a budget. While buying a premium pram is necessary, many budget friendly alternatives are readily available without compromising safety or comfort.
Practical Tips for Selecting the Right Pram
Choosing the best pram is not practically liking the style; it's about discovering the ideal suitable for your lifestyle. Here are some useful tips to guide your decision-making:
1. Assess Your Lifestyle
Consider your daily routine and activities. Do you live in the city, or do you frequent parks and trails? Are you a parent who travels often? Your response will notify which type of pram is best fit for you.
2. Do Your Research
Read reviews, enjoy video presentations, and request for suggestions from buddies or family who are moms and dads. Online online forums can provide insights into the experiences of other moms and dads.
3. Test Before You Buy
Whenever possible, test out prams in-store. Push them around, inspect the foldability, and see how easy they are to operate.
4. Consider Longevity
Believe about for how long you prepare to utilize the pram. Some models are created to grow with your kid, with convertibility choices or accommodating extra seats, which can conserve you cash in the long run.
5. Budget plan Wisely
While it's tempting to go for the most inexpensive option, consider investing a bit more in quality. A long lasting pram can last for years and throughout numerous kids if you prepare to broaden your household.
FAQs About Prams
Q1: At what age can a baby start using a pram?
A: Most prams are suitable for newborns when they lie flat. Guarantee the pram has a totally reclining seat for young infants. Numerous prams can also accommodate infant cars and truck seats for ease.
Q2: How do I clean and maintain my pram?
A: Regularly clean down the frame and wash the material according to the maker's directions. Examine the wheels for debris and clean them to ensure smooth operation.
Q3: Can I use a pram for running?
A: Only if it is specifically designed for running. Routine prams are not made for high-speed activities and can be risky.
Q4: Are double prams worth the investment?
A: If you have twins or siblings close in age, a double pram can be a lifesaver. It allows you to transfer both kids concurrently, making getaways more manageable.
Q5: What should I do if my pram becomes damaged?
A: Check if the pram includes a service warranty. Numerous makers use repair work services or replacement parts for harmed units.
